Compared with sixteen control animals infused with saline, plasma renin-substrate concentration increased twofold (P < 0.001) in twenty-two rats following infusion of angiotensin II at a mean rate of 191 ng kg−1 min−1 for 13 h. 2. The change was not attributable to an overall increase of plasma protein concentration.
